My mum has bought a house, and the previous owner had Hive installed..my mum will not need this, and will not have a need for broadband either..
Does anyone know how we would go back to using a simple thermostat/boiler? Or does someone need to come and uninstall the Hive system?

The thermostat uses radio frequency (RF) between the boiler and the thermostat, rather than broadband.

Yes you can set the timer on the thermostat.

The little white hub uses broadband. That's to control it via a smartphone or laptop.
